Quiz Answer Key and Fun Facts
1. Where and when was Wong Fei-Hung born?

Answer: Fushan district, 1847

Wong was his family name. In China the family name came first. Thus everyone of the Wong family was called Wong "so and so".
2. Wong Fei-Hung was known as many things. What three things was he most notably known as?

Answer: a martial artist, an intellect and a healer

Though Wong Fei-Hung has been quoted as being many things, including a hero, he is most known for his martial arts including the creation of new movements, his healing which combined chi and herbal medicine and his intellect. Many martial artists were also Taoist and philosophers.
3. What system was Wong Fei-Hung credited for creating?

Answer: Hung Gar, Tiger Crane

Hung Gar was a martial arts systems from the southern shaolin temple. It was a family system from the Hung family that utilized tiger, crane, snake, dragon and panther moves. It was most known for its stance training where the students were known to have to maintain a horse stand for hours at a time. Fei-Hung's original teacher was Lam Fuk Sing, later his father Kay-Ying took over his training.
4. Though in martial arts, especially Chinese martial arts, you learn the use of many weapons, what is the weapon that Wong Fei-Hung was most known for?

Answer: Staff (Gun)

Wong Fei-Hung was known for defending the weak from criminals. His Shaolin Staff fighting skills were legendary; one time he single-handedly defeated a 30 man gang with nothing more than a staff!
5. Wong Fei-Hung and his father were known as two of the best fighters in China. What were the best fighters known as?

Answer: 10 Tigers of Canton

The 10 Tigers of Canton were considered the greatest of all the martial artists of their time. This is how Wong got one of his nicknames which ment "Tiger".
6. Wong Fei-Hung's father owned one of the most famous "clinics" in all of China. What was it called?

Answer: Po Chi Lam

Po Chi Lam was the famous "clinic" Po Chi Lam was a place of healing and center for learning. More then what we think of as a modern day clinic. Yi Yuan is hospital, and Yi Wu Shi and Yi Wu Suo are both clinics. Wong and his father not only healed the sick, but also promoted health through their martial arts.
7. Sometimes money was hard to come by for the poor. What would Fei-Hung do if a patient was too poor to pay? What would his Father do?

Answer: Both Fei-Hung and Kay-Ying would treat a patient regardless. They would only charge what they could afford to pay.

Kay-Ying was known for treating a patient regardless of whether they could pay or not. He taught these good morals to his son, Fei-Hung, who continued with the tradition of treating everyone he could. This is one of the many things that made Fei-Hung so famous.
8. Wong Fei-Hung was trained in Chinese medicine. Which of the following is not an example of Chinese medicine that he might have practiced?

Answer: Qigong

Acupuncture is a practice of using needles along the meridians to stimulate and redirect the flow of chi for healing purposes.

Herbs were a very popular method of healing in any culture, China had many salves, oils, teas, ointments etc that used herbs.

Dietary therapy was very important in healing, what one eat affect there whole system, and usually was restricted after treatment.

Qigong is a breathing technique used to stimulate health and vital energies in the body. Though one may do Qigong breathing and exercise before doing hoslistic therapy, it's not a method of treating patients.
9. Wong Fei-Hung was known for a legendary technique that was so fast it was considered unblockable. There are many sugestions of how this technique was used but the name is still known to this day. What is it?

Answer: Shadowless or No-Shadow Kick

The Shadowless Kick! Some say it's a kick combo done in the air where he would kick multiple times before landing. Others say he threw a kick with such speed that it was not seen. Some say it's a rapid fire kick thrown with blinding speed at the same spot. Today it's practiced as a low kick, which is thrown after distracting with the hands, giving the impression it came from nowhere.
10. Wong Fei-Hung was married four times how did he meet his last wife?

Answer: During a lion dance he accidently hit her in the face with his shoe.

Mok Gwai Lan was Fei-Hung's last wife, and a very accomplished martial artist in the Mok Gar style. It is said that though he pursued her to apologize, she refused. He had to pursue her for a while before he finally won her hand in marriage. Cute I know.
